Sorts Of Stress Washing Machines



When it concerns push cleaning, comprehending the various sorts of stress washing machines readily available can make a significant distinction in your cleansing efficiency.

You'll usually come across 3 main types: electric, gas, and warm water stress washers.

Electric stress washing machines are suitable for light-duty tasks, such as washing automobiles or cleaning patio areas. They're quieter, much easier to make use of, and perfect for smaller sized tasks around your home.

If you require even more power for harder jobs, gas stress washers are the means to go. They're extra effective and can deal with durable tasks like removing paint or cleansing large driveways. However, they call for more upkeep and can be a bit louder.

For those truly challenging jobs, hot water pressure washing machines provide the best cleaning power. They heat up the water, making it efficient for getting rid of grease and oil stains. These are commonly used in commercial setups but can be helpful for domestic customers tackling challenging cleaning projects.



Selecting the ideal type of stress washer for your demands will aid you save effort and time, ensuring you do the job successfully.

Best Practices for Pressure Laundering



Among the most effective practices for pressure cleaning is to begin with a thorough evaluation of the surface you'll be cleaning up. Check for any damages, loosened materials, or locations that need unique treatment. This will certainly assist you adjust your pressure and technique as necessary.

Next off, choose the ideal nozzle and stress setting for the job. A wide-angle nozzle is great for fragile surfaces, while a slim one functions well for tougher spots. Constantly start with the lowest pressure and gradually increase it if needed.

Before you start, clear the location of any barriers and secure plants, windows, and various other surface areas that might be damaged by the spray.

When washing, maintain the nozzle at a constant distance from the surface area, and make use of sweeping movements to avoid touches. Work inside out so that dirt and particles fall away as you cleanse.

Finally, rinse the location completely to eliminate any type of soap or cleansing solution deposits. After you're done, evaluate your job to ensure you didn't miss out on any places.

Complying with these finest practices will help you achieve the most effective outcomes while lengthening the life of your surfaces.
